On Tuesday 24 February, tamariki and whānau are invited to come together for a Purple Poppy Day commemoration at Pukeahu National War Memorial Park. The event will start at the fountain steps opposite Anzac Square at 5.15pm.In the event of bad weather, please check this page and Pukeahu National War Memorial Park Facebook for updates.Purple Poppy ceremonyAt this special ceremony, hear stories remembering courageous service animals and meet Paradox the horse and Kingi the dog, who will join the event to represent the heroes in these stories. Guests are invited to lay a purple poppy at the Man and the Donkey Memorial or chalk paint a purple poppy and message of acknowledgement into the park.About Purple Poppy DayPurple Poppy Day honours the animals who served alongside people in times of war, companions whose loyalty and courage are woven into New Zealand’s military history.War animals and the purple poppy (NZ History)
